Handover — Supplier Contract Renewal (Brellick Components)

From D. Varano to T. Okker. Brellick renewal due end of quarter. Pricing up 6%; volume rebates unchanged. Legal has redlined clauses 4 and 9. Alternate supplier Quenmore scoped but not engaged. Recommend renewing for 18 months, not 36. Board vote required. Context the board should see before deciding follows below.

board note of bawep-tajef: Queniusek Systems plans to raise the Quenvan list price by 53.1 percent in March. The pricing group signed off on a budget of $176.4 million for Project Drueth. The renewal with Casionix Partners closes at $142.5 million a year, 8.3 percent below the last contract. Project Fraax slips by six weeks because of the tooling delay.

== Build provenance: Sweepwright retention sweeper ==

Quick primer for the weekly sync: every Sweepwright release is built in the sealed Farrowmill pipeline, and the provenance record ties the binary back to the exact commit, builder image, and policy bundle it shipped with. This matters because the sweeper deletes data — if it misbehaves, we need to prove which rules it was actually running. Provenance lookups start from the token below.

session token of tajef-bageg = htk21_5d90d574934f3ccae6437

Facilities ticket — Halewick Tower, night shift.

Issue: support team reporting east stairwell reader rejecting badges after midnight. Reader was reset this morning; firmware updated. Overnight crew should now badge as normal. If the reader fails again, use the manual keypad by the fire door — do not prop the door. Log any further failures with the time and badge name. Temporary keypad code for the fallback door is below.

door code, tajeg-fawip: bdg-K-62

# Autocomplete Index — Who to Contact

The suggest index for Murmurly search has been slow since the shard split in Q3. Known symptoms: p99 latency over 400ms, stale suggestions after catalog updates. Owner: the Findability squad. They triage performance reports weekly; anything affecting live traffic gets same-day attention. Before reporting, check the index-lag dashboard and note the shard ID — reports without it get deprioritized. Rebuild requests go through the squad, never run them yourself. Send reports and rebuild requests here.

escalation mailbox, bafog-fafog: ulador@paliqlabs.internal